Artist sheds light on Northern Soul

A CHESTER art gallery is hosting an event to celebrate the work of a contemporary artist.

From window cleaner to widely-acclaimed observer of northern life, the enigmatic Alexander Millar will be visiting Castle Galleries, St Michael’s Row, The Mall Grosvenor, tomorrow (April 19) from noon-3pm.

He will be unveiling his latest body of work entitled Northern Soul, which will feature in the gallery from mid-April and throughout the summer.

Gallery manager John Cheadle said: “We are thrilled to have this talented artist come to Chester and we’ll be serving up champagne to mark this special event in the gallery.

“Alexander Millar really is a breath of fresh air and his art has proved hugely popular amongst a growing band of loyal collectors and new fans discovering his unique ‘Gadgie’ style.”

Despite never receiving any professional tuition, Millar enjoyed early success with a number of sell-out exhibitions at the start of his career.

His first paintings were landscapes but, following a move from Scotland to Newcastle, he found himself becoming fascinated by the lives of Newcastle’s working class ‘Gadgies’ in their baggy suits and flat-caps, which became the entire focus for his work.

His unique, witty and poignant portrayal of these characters are instantly recognisable and a huge hit amongst art fans.

Millar’s latest collection features six new limited edition pieces and include Take The High Road, We’ll Meet Again, Northern Lights, Home is Where the Heart Is, Reach For The Sky and When The Boat Comes In.
